53 St Lukes Road is a 185 m² / 1,991 sq ft detached home in Bournemouth. It sold for £500,000 in August 2015. Indexed forward to today's value, that sale is roughly £660k. Recent local prices imply a broad valuation context of £548k to £832k based on its internal area. The Land Registry and EPC data was last updated 1 June 2026.
